#334469 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#334469 is composed of 20% red, 26.7% green and 41.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 51.4% cyan, 35.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 58.8% black. It has a hue angle of 221.1 degrees, a saturation of 34.6% and a lightness of 30.6%. #334469 color hex could be obtained by blending #6688d2 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333366.

Shades and Tints of #334469
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#06080d is the darkest color, while #fefeff is the lightest one.

Tones of #334469
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4b4d51 is the less saturated color, while #033299 is the most saturated one.
